Preguntas frecuentes sobre Lanham
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Lanham?
Actualmente hay 26 Apartamentos Estudios en Lanham con alquileres que van desde $1,052 hasta $2,575, con un precio medio de $1,751.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Lanham?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Lanham varian entre $1,199 y $3,201 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,841
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Lanham?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Lanham van desde $1,185 hasta $3,301.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,043
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Lanham?
En estos momentos hay 62 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Lanham en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,699 y $6,202 - con una media de $2,362 para el lugar.
